The Lives to Come: the Genetic Revolution and Human Possibilities Philip Kitcher Reprint edition
The Lives to Come: the Genetic Revolution and Human Possibilities
Philip Kitcher
A critically praised survey explores the ethical, legal, political, and social concerns surrounding today's revolutionary genetic research, illustrated with examples, case studies, and scenarios drawn from real life and real science. Reprint. 15,000 first printing."
